SPD officers participate in Crisis Intervention Team Training in Appleton.
CIT (Crisis Intervention Team) is a comprehensive five-day, 40 hour training session designed to assist law enforcement officers and other first responders in recognizing and understanding the signs and symptoms of mental illness including depression, bipolar disorder, schizophrenia and anxiety disorders, as well as other associated illnesses including developmental & and cognitive disorders and dementia.
